A Comprehensive Guide to Weather Forecasts



Weather forecasting is an essential part of daily life, affecting whatever from our everyday plans to critical decisions in agriculture, aviation, and emergency management. Weather forecasting has actually evolved tremendously over time, from ancient approaches of observing natural indications to today's sophisticated models powered by supercomputers. Regardless of its improvements, weather forecasting stays a blend of science and art, where information, technology, and human proficiency converge to forecast the environment's future behavior.

The Science Behind Weather Forecasting

The precision of a weather report depends heavily on the quality and amount of data gathered. Weather data is sourced from a variety of instruments, consisting of ground-based weather stations, satellites, and radar systems. These tools step crucial climatic variables like temperature level, humidity, wind speed, and pressure. Satellites, for instance, provide real-time pictures of cloud developments and storm systems, while radar helps identify rainfall and its intensity.

As soon as this data is collected, it is processed through numerical weather prediction (NWP) designs. These models utilize complicated mathematical formulas to mimic the environment's dynamics and predict future weather patterns. Various kinds of models exist, with some covering the whole globe and others concentrating on specific areas with greater information. However, the function of human meteorologists stays important, as they analyze the model outputs, change them for local conditions, and interact uncertainties to the general public.

Understanding Different Weather Forecasts

Weather forecasts can differ significantly depending upon the time frame they cover and the specific requirements they deal with. Short-term forecasts, normally covering to 48 hours, are extremely detailed and trusted, making them vital for daily planning. Medium-term forecasts, covering from three to 7 days, offer a wider view and work for more prolonged planning purposes.

Long-term forecasts, which look weeks or perhaps months ahead, focus on patterns instead of specific conditions and are typically used in industries like farming. In addition to these general forecasts, there are specific ones customized for specific sectors, such as air travel, marine operations, and farming, which consider distinct ecological aspects.

The Challenges and Limitations of Weather Forecasting

Despite the considerable development made in weather forecasting, several difficulties stay. The inherent uncertainty of the designs utilized can result in variations in forecasts, as various models may anticipate a little different outcomes. This is why ensemble forecasting, which runs several designs to assess a variety of possibilities, is often used.

Data spaces likewise pose an obstacle, particularly in remote areas or over oceans where less observations are available. The chaotic nature of the atmosphere even more complicates predictions, especially for long-term forecasts, which are normally less exact.

Interpreting Weather Forecasts

Understanding how to read and translate a weather report can greatly improve its effectiveness. Weather signs are a typical function in forecasts, with icons representing sun, clouds, rain, and other conditions. Terms like "partially cloudy" or "chance of showers" indicate the possibility of specific weather occurring.

Wind forecasts Click here are also essential, especially for outside activities and air travel. Wind instructions and speed can have a substantial influence on temperature level understanding and weather patterns. Furthermore, air pressure patterns are essential signs of altering weather, with high-pressure systems usually bringing clear skies and low-pressure systems related to stormier conditions.
